How much can you earn on Airbnb in Teloché, Pays de la Loire? Based on AirROI's 2026 dataset (April 2025 – March 2026), the short answer is $9,108 per year — at a $180 nightly rate, 28.3% occupancy, and a $50 RevPAR that reflects a wider gap between nightly rates and realized revenue that rewards occupancy-focused strategies.

At 58 active listings, Teloché is a boutique market where selective demand that rewards strong listing quality and pricing strategy. Supply grew 286.7% year over year, and the market is recalibrating around a new competitive baseline. This is the stage where hosts who invest in amenities, guest experience, and dynamic pricing build durable advantages that compound as the market matures.

Regulation is low with minimal registration requirements, pointing to an operator-friendly environment. In a market this size, differentiated listings with strong reviews can capture outsized returns relative to the competition.

When Is the Peak Season for Airbnb in Teloché?

Teloché's peak Airbnb season falls in April, May, September, while the softest stretch is January, February, March. Overall, the market sh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y, which should guide pricing, minimum stays, and cash-flow planning.

Peak Season (April, May, September)
  • Revenue averages $1,945 per month
  • Occupancy rates average 37.1%
  • Daily rates average $179
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$1,286 per month
  • Occupancy maintains around 24.6%
  • Daily rates hold near $192
Low Season (January, February, March)
  • Revenue drops to average $778 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to average 15.8%
  • Daily rates adjust to average $212

Seasonality Insights for Teloché

  • Airbnb seasonality in Teloché is pronounced. Revenue swings sharply between peak and low months, which means pricing strategy, minimum-stay settings, and cash reserves all need to account for extended slower periods.
  • During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Teloché's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ues climbing to $1,993, occupancy reaching 39.5%, and ADRs peaking at $215.
  • Conversely, the slowest single month marks the market's lowest point — revenue may dip to $715, occupancy could drop to 14.5%, and ADRs may adjust to $173.
  • Lower occupancy paired with meaningful seasonality means hosts in Teloché need to maximize every peak-season booking and seriously consider whether off-season pricing adjustments or minimum-stay changes can capture incremental revenue.

How Far in Advance Do Guests Book Airbnb in Teloché?

Average Booking Lead Time by Month

Booking Lead Time Insights for Teloché

  • The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Teloché is 79 days.
  • Guests book furthest in advance for stays during May (average 115 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
  • The shortest booking windows occur for stays in January (average 21 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
  • Seasonally, Summer (88 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Winter (26 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
